Nabikarbonatcotransportøren, also known as the sodium-bicarbonate cotransporter or NBC, is a protein family that plays a crucial role in the transport of bicarbonate ions across cell membranes. These transporters utilize the electrochemical gradient of sodium ions to drive the movement of bicarbonate, facilitating both influx and efflux depending on the specific transporter isoform and cellular conditions. NBCs are ubiquitously expressed in various tissues throughout the body, including the kidneys, brain, pancreas, and skeletal muscle. Their primary function is to maintain cellular pH homeostasis by regulating the intracellular concentration of bicarbonate, a key buffer in biological systems. Beyond pH regulation, NBCs are also involved in other physiological processes such as fluid secretion, nutrient absorption, and the regulation of membrane potential. Dysfunction of nabikarbonatcotransportøren has been implicated in a range of pathological conditions, including metabolic acidosis, neurological disorders, and cystic fibrosis. Research into these transporters continues to uncover their diverse roles and potential therapeutic targets.
